US population growth slowed overall in the last decade and almost all increases were in cities, new 2020 Census data shows
The data, based on last year's once-a-decade canvassing, showed that population growth in the United States over the past decade has slowed, as 52% of counties have smaller populations in 2020 than they did in 2010. Instead, almost all of the nation's population growth was in its cities, the data showed, a trend sure to highlight the urban-rural divide already prominent in American politics.
Census Bureau releases long-awaited data from 2020 survey "Metro areas are even more prominent this decade as the locations of population growth amidst otherwise widespread population decline," said Marc Perry, senior demographer of the US Census Bureau population Division, at a Census Bureau news conference Thursday.The data is coming more than four months later than usual -- after some states' deadlines to have new maps in place have already passed.
